Marine Le Pen, The Rise Of The French Right And The New French Revolution By Shoebat on April 22, 2025 in Featured, General, Highlight print Share this:FacebookTwitterRedditLinkedInPrintMoreSkypeWhatsAppTelegramPocketPinterestTumblr CLICK HERE TO DONATE NOW